THE STATE HOUSE COLUMBIA, S. C.
Begun in 1851 the huge edifice, scarred by Sherman's
shells, is a favorite tourist attraction. Built of local
granite the uncompleted capitol of S. C. was designed
by a Viennese architect, John R. Niernsee.
